[quote=Anonymous]If you hear that they're repeatedly having trouble, you need to intervene more promptly and help them figure out how to communicate. Your kid may not be the biter but your kid may, for example, be the one who is refusing to compromise. Figure out what the problem is and help them deal with it. Sometimes they may need to be shepherded on to a different game or activity, and sometimes a more "parallel play" type of activity can diffuse the situation (ex. drawing or playdough). [/quote]
